how fast or slow the game will run in a certain area. like a movie has hundreds of frames going by a second. each film cell if u will is going by relly fast to make the picture move. the higher the frames per second (FPS) then the faster it runs. the lower, the slower the game runs. the loest ive ever seen on any game is about 30 FPS cuz my cpu so dam fast! i love it!
